Valve and five game publishers fined millions for geo-blocking Steam games in EU

The Verge

This broke the EU’s Digital Single Market rules which prohibit those types of barriers. The European Commission says the geo-blocking was to prevent games being activated outside Czechia, Poland, Hungary, Romania, Slovakia, Estonia, Latvia and Lithuania. Five publishers were fined in total. Focus Home was fined almost €2.9

Yapily to acquire finAPI in open banking consolidation move

TechCrunch

It offers an API with coverage in Germany, Austria, Czech Republic, Hungary and Slovakia. Yapily currently covers 16 European markets and the company says it is the leader in the U.K. But the startup isn’t currently active in Czech Republic, Slovakia and Hungary.

Google Stadia expands to eight more European countries, just in time for Cyberpunk 2077

The Verge

The new markets include Austria, Czechia, Hungary, Poland, Portugal, Romania, Slovakia, and Switzerland, bringing the total number of countries the cloud gaming service supports from 14 to 22. Photo by Amelia Holowaty Krales / The Verge. Google Stadia is expanding internationally, adding eight more countries in Europe today.
